Abbe Lowell, a well-known Washington attorney recognized for his defense of Hunter Biden against various criminal charges, has established a new law firm called Lowell & Associates. This firm aims to represent former government officials and others who have been targeted by investigations stemming from the Trump administration. Lowell's departure from Winston & Strawn, a large law firm, marks a significant shift in his career as he focuses on defending clients facing what he describes as politicized investigations, civil actions, and administrative challenges. The firm has also attracted two former lawyers from Skadden, Arps, Slate, Meagher & Flom, who resigned due to the firm's compliance with Trump’s executive orders that they felt compromised the integrity of the legal profession. This move emphasizes a growing concern among legal professionals regarding the politicization of the legal system under the previous administration.

In addition to representing clients such as New York Attorney General Letitia James—who has faced allegations from the Trump administration—Lowell & Associates is also involved in cases challenging the cancellation of federal grant funding by government entities. The firm’s establishment is part of a larger movement to counteract legal actions taken during Trump's presidency, which have led to over 200 lawsuits aimed at challenging key policy initiatives, including restrictions on transgender and immigrant rights. Organizations like Democracy Forward have been proactive in filing legal actions, with recent hires indicating a concerted effort to navigate the current legal landscape. The situation reflects a broader trend of legal resistance against perceived government overreach, highlighting the evolving dynamics of law and politics in the United States as former officials seek representation against what they view as unjust targeting by the government.

A prominent lawyer in Washington who defended Hunter Biden against criminal charges has launched a new law firm to represent former government officials and others targeted by theTrump administration.

Abbe Lowell left his large law firm, Winston & Strawn, to launch Lowell & Associates, which will defend clients including individuals, institutions and others that are “facing politicized investigations, civil and administrative actions”, the firm said in a Friday statement.

The new firm also includes two former lawyers at Skadden, Arps, Slate, Meagher & Flom who quit over its response toDonald Trump’s executive orders targeting the legal profession.

Skaddenis one ofnine firms thatcut dealswith the administration to avoid the Republican president’scrackdown on the legal industry. Four other firmshavesuedto block Trump’s orders, which restricted their business over the president’s claims that they had “weaponized” the legal system against him or his allies.

One of the ex-Skadden lawyers, Rachel Cohen, said there is a need for attorneys “willing to stand up to the government when it oversteps”.

Two other lawyers are also joining the new firm from Winston & Strawn.

Lowell is representing the New York attorney general, Letitia James, after theTrump administrationreferred her to the justice department for allegedly falsifying real estate records. James has denied the allegations.

The new firm said it was also representing clients fighting the cancellation of grant funding by the so-called “department of government efficiency” and the federal government.

Lowell represented Hunter Biden, former president Joe Biden’s son, against criminal gun and tax changes before he waspardonedin December. His clients have also included the former US senator Bob Menendez, Ivanka Trump and Jared Kushner.

The establishment of the new firm comes amid a broader effort to mount and sustain legal challenges to the Trump administration.

There are more than 200 lawsuits opposing key Trump policy initiatives, including efforts to curtail transgender and immigrant rights, and eliminating agency and grant funding.

The advocacy group Democracy Forward, which has filed more than 50 legal actions since the election, said this week it had hired Brian Netter, a former partner at Mayer Brown and a top attorney in the Biden-era justice department.

Netter said in a statement that he was joining the organization during “what may be the most consequential moment in the history of the US courts”.
